Rescue drone development significance
 
With the maturity of drone technology and the further expansion of aerial photography technology, our national UAV applications are becoming more and more extensive, including: photogrammetry, emergency response, public safety, resource exploration, environmental monitoring, natural disaster monitoring and evaluation, Urban planning and municipal management, forest fire pest protection and monitoring.
 
As early as the end of the 1990s, the United States began to apply drones to disaster monitoring and rescue, but in China, drones have not been put into emergency applications such as earthquake disasters. Until 2008, the Wenchuan Earthquake occurred. The Chinese Academy of Sciences research team first tried to apply the remote sensing drone to the epicenter of the epicenter, and then in the post-disaster emergency rescue such as Yushu, Heshan and Lushan earthquakes, the remote sensing drones played for the first time. The more important the role. The practice of multiple emergency rescues proves that the drone can quickly enter the aerial photography of the disaster area after the earthquake. Now it can remotely and real-time command and return clear images in real time. The drone is low in cost, easy to operate, and quick to respond. The investigation is more efficient; with drones, experts can concentrate on the rear and quickly assess the damage, so they have unique advantages.
 
In addition to the aerial disaster situation, the current UAV technology can also realize the mounting of a variety of load modules, "transformation" mobile communication base stations, as well as the rescue potential of post-disaster transportation, delivery of materials, and shouting. Therefore, the drone will be an indispensable or even irreplaceable aviation force in emergency rescue.
 
Rescue robot development significance
 
In recent years, emergencies such as wars and terrorist attacks, natural disasters such as earthquakes and tsunamis, and potential nuclear, chemical, biological and explosive materials have seriously threatened human life and property. As the number of disasters increases, its severity, diversity, and complexity increase. 72h after the disaster occurred as a gold rescue time, but due to the unstructured environment at the disaster site, rescuers were unable to work quickly, efficiently, and safely, and the rescue mission gradually exceeded the capabilities of rescuers. Therefore, the rescue robot Has become an important development direction.
 
Through summarization and summary, the rescue robot has the following four advantages: 1) strong mobility and handling ability, and continuous operation through battery replenishment, improve search and rescue efficiency; 2) can carry a variety of sensors to achieve the map inside the ruins , sound, gas, temperature and other tests, effectively lock the victim's position; 3) fast speed; 4) robot rescue can assist or replace rescuers, avoid the damage caused by the second collapse, reduce the risk of rescue workers.
